UK on alert for al-Tawhid cell
Security chiefs have had intelligence for nearly a year about an al Qaida supporting splinter group based in Luton and London where many of today’s raids took place. Leaked German intelligence documents revealed last May that a cell linked to the “al Tawhid” group was operating there. At least six addresses were raided in Luton today, and more in London, although it was not clear whether there were any connections to al Tawhid. The presence of the group in Luton and London came to light after some of its members were arrested in Germany in 2002 and 2003 amid allegations of links to the “Hamburg cell” which took part in the September 11 hijackings. Abu Qatada, the Palestinian-Jordanian cleric who is currently held without charge in Belmarsh prison under the Anti-Terrorism Crime and Security Act 2001, is argued by Home Secretary David Blunkett to have been the spiritual adviser to al Tawhid.
